For the record, there's nothing wrong with having both Wriggle's and bloodrazor on WW :P

For jungle, I use a Long Sword opening into Wriggle's Lantern, Mercury's Treads, Wit's End and Sunfire Aegis (order depending on resistance needs), Spirit Visage, and then finish out with either Madred's Bloodrazor or something tankier such as a Banshee's Veil.

Lane still works, using a Chalice of Harmony opening, but it's not at the level of immovability that it used to be.

As for AP, it's super fun, and crushes low CC team comps. I find it's better for duo lanes. It has a much higher risk/reward ratio than a tankier warwick build, but it can work. If you get behind though, you almost always lose.

I like to build a little AP for my Lanewick, and I actually have a lot of success with it.

I start off with a Doran's Ring and max out my Q right away, and after that Sorceror's Shoes, and by then your Q will be destroying anyone without absurd amounts of health or Magic Resist/armor. After that I take a malady, then build into Madred's, then after that I go tanky, maybe a Spirit Visage and Guardian Angel or something like that to annoy them.

I love harassing, so the Q is awesome for that. As an added bonus, the increased damage you do with it gives you more lifesteal and you can sustain yourself in lane for a long time if you have mana regen runes.

The problems I have with this build are:

1. Ranged-only lanes can be a nightmare without your ulti or someone else in your lane with a CC.

2. You have to be careful not to feed your lane and get kills/farm, because if not, you won't be as powerful later on.

3. While I have games where I get absurd amounts of kills, I also have games where I get tons of assists and maybe 1 or 2 kills, which isn't really bad if your teammates are getting a lot of kills themselves, but sometimes bothers me.

Let me know if there are problems with that, but I've had a lot of success with this build so far, even beating AD Warwicks on the enemy team.
